Step 3: ACT engineering of the feeder bays at Section 2
Identical steps to Step 2 shall be done for the feeders located at the second section,
namely Section 2. The only difference is that in Section 2, the relevant zones are Z4,
Z5 and Z6.
ACT configuration example for Feeder 17 located at Section 2 is given in Figure
78.
Any other feeders located at Section 2 shall be engineered in the similar way.
